How they compare
Malta currently reports 4.1% against 3.7% in Bahrain, a difference of 0.4%.
That makes Malta's figure about 1.1 times Bahrain's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Bahrain ahead.
Bahrain ranks 22nd and Malta ranks 19th of 50 countries.
